Heart chamber into which the blood enters

Name the first human heart chamber into which the blood enters? Where does the blood go subsequent to passing that chamber? Give the name of valve which separates the compartments? Why is that valve essential?

The venous blood which comes from the tissues arrives in the right atrium of heart. From the right atrium, the blood goes to the right ventricle. The valve which separates the right ventricle from right atrium is the tricuspid valve (that is, a valvular system made up of three leaflets). The tricuspid valve is essential to prevent returning of blood to the right atrium throughout systole (that is, contraction of ventricles).
